メモリ コンテキストについて取得する情報を指定します。
構文
public enum enum_CONTEXT_INFO_FIELDS {
CIF_MODULEURL = 0x00000001,
CIF_FUNCTION = 0x00000002,
CIF_FUNCTIONOFFSET = 0x00000004,
CIF_ADDRESS = 0x00000008,
CIF_ADDRESSOFFSET = 0x00000010,
CIF_ADDRESSABSOLUTE = 0x00000020,
CIF_ALLFIELDS = 0x0000003f
};
フィールド
CIF_MODULEURL
CONTEXT_INFO 構造体の bstrModuleUrl
フィールドを初期化および使用します。
CIF_FUNCTION
CONTEXT_INFO
構造体の bstrFunction
フィールドを初期化または使用します。
CIF_FUNCTIONOFFSET
CONTEXT_INFO
構造体の posFunctionOffset
フィールドを初期化または使用します。
CIF_ADDRESS
CONTEXT_INFO
構造体の bstrAddress
フィールドを初期化または使用します。
CIF_ADDRESSOFFSET
CONTEXT_INFO
構造体の bstrAddressOffset
フィールドを初期化または使用します。
CIF_ALLFIELDS
CONTEXT_INFO
構造体のすべてのフィールドを初期化または使用します。
解説
これらの値は、CONTEXT_INFO 構造体のどのフィールドを初期化するかを示すために、GetInfo メソッドにパラメーターとして渡されます。
これらのフラグは、CONTEXT_INFO
構造体のどのフィールドが使用されているか、またこの構造体が返されるときにどのフィールドが有効であるかを示すためにも使用されます。
これらの値は、ビットごとの OR で組み合わせることができます。
要件
ヘッダー: msdbg.h
名前空間: Microsoft.VisualStudio.Debugger.Interop
アセンブリ: Microsoft.VisualStudio.Debugger.Interop.dll